Frank Morton Mcmurry

Frank Morton McMurry (1862-1936) was an American educator and a brother of Charles Alexander McMurry. Born near Crawfordsville, Indiana, McMurry studied at the University of Michigan and at Halle and Jena in Europe, earning a Ph.D. in 1889. Before teaching in higher education, he served as the principal of Carter High School (Englewood).
